Transaction c87af63a1ca94c207da60702329c4e1a389ae42ca1421e286d9d0322bb515023
1 Input
1 Output
-
c87af63a1ca94c207da60702329c4e1a389ae42ca1421e286d9d0322bb515023:0
- value
- 145475
- script pubkey
- OP_0 OP_PUSHBYTES_32 27fb589a4ac35ca6aaa108327d1b0d7129ef1430ffcb94907fcfd26f81f42d94
- address
- bc1qyla43xj2cdw2d24ppqe86xcdwy5779psll9efyrlelfxlq059k2q8tyg53